The book summarizes the current state of knowledge in key research areas and contain ideas for future product development. Nuts contain a number of bioactives and health-promoting components. They are highly nutritious and contain macronutrients, micronutrients, fat-soluble bioactives, and phytochemicals. Moreover, nuts contain numerous types of antioxidants with different properties. In addition, nuts are recognized for their health-promoting aspects, particularly for their role in reducing cardiovascular disease risk. This may be due to the favorable lipid profile and low-glycemic nature of nuts. Dried fruits, which serve as important healthful snacks worldwide, provide a concentrated form of fresh fruits. They are nutritionally equivalent to fresh fruits in smaller serving sizes, ranging from 30 to 43 g depending on the fruit, in current dietary recommendation in different countries. Various scientific evidence suggest that individuals who consume dried fruits regularly have a lower risk of cardiovascular disease, obesity, certain types of cancer, type II diabetes, metabolic syndrome, inflammatory bowel disease, and osteoporosis as well as other non-communicable diseases.
